WEST RUGBY DERBY Bath v Exeter team news

official bath rugby logo courtesy & copyright bath rugbyexeter chiefs rugby logo courtesy & copyright exeter chiefs rugbyIt's the biggest rugby match in the region at the Rec tomorrow as Bath host Exeter in the Aviva Premiership Westcountry derby (1430ko).

Carl Fearns returns to the Bath back row while in the front row Paul James and David Wilson - selected in the Wales and England squads respectively for the autumn internationals - pack down either side of Devon-born hooker Lee Mears.

Try scorers against Agen, Michael Claassens and Stephen Donald renew their half-back partnership for the hosts.

On the bench, Bath club captain Stuart Hooper makes his first appearance since the game against Sale Sharks four weeks ago while Argentinian Horacio Agulla is set for his first appearance after international duty in the Rugby Championship.

Exeter head coach Rob Baxter calls two internationals into his starting XV.

Australian lock Dean Mumm returns in the second row in place of club captain Tom Hayes while Argentinian wing Gonzalo Camacho makes his first appearance of the season.

On the bench, scrum-half Kevin Barrett replaces injured Will Chudley while Academy product Dave Ewers offers back row options.
